Scamming Web Designers?

I got this via the JFP’s contact form today:

I’m XXXX,I am an hearing impaired,I would love to know if you can handle website design for a new company and also if you do you accept credit cards ?? kindly get back to me ASAP via my e-mail(XXXX1960@outlook.com) so i can send you the job details.

And thought to myself… well, I guess it’d be rude not to write back, even though this sounds scam-y. But then I googled that whole paragraph and came upon this:

http://blog.ihenix.com/nearly-got-scammed/

The money quote from iHenix:

Seriously? She wants me to charge her credit card and then send money to someone else? Plus I receive a $200 tip? I hate to use an old cliche but if it seems too good to be true, it probably is. 

So, just a heads up (and to drop this into Google in case others are searching and need additional confirmation) caveat designer.
